답안 #833343

# 제출 시각 아이디 문제 언어 결과 실행 시간 메모리
833343 2023-08-22T04:44:54 Z vjudge1 Exam (eJOI20_exam) C++14
12 / 100
58 ms 1488 KB
#include<bits/stdc++.h>
using namespace std;

int main(){
	//12 poin :))
	int n;
	cin>>n;
	vector<int> a(n+2),b(n+2),c(n+2);
	for(int i=1; i<=n; i++){
		cin>>a[i];
	}
	for(int i=1; i<=n; i++){
		cin>>b[i];
	}
	int x=b[1];
	for(int i=1; i<=n;i++){
		if(c[i]==1)continue;
		
		if(a[i]==x){
			c[i]=1;
			int j=i+1;
			while(a[j]<=x&&j<=n){
				a[j]=x;
				c[j]=1;
				j++;
			}
			
			j=i-1;
			while(a[j]<=x&&1<=j){
				if(c[j]==1)break;
				a[j]=x;
				c[j]=1;
				j--;
			}
			
		}
	}
	int ans=0;
	for(int i=1;i<=n;i++){
//		cout<<a[i]<<" ";
		if(a[i]==b[i])ans++;
	}
	cout<<ans<<"\n";
	return 0;
}

/*
5
1 1 1 1 2
2 2 2 2 2 
*/
# 결과 실행 시간 메모리 Grader output
1 Incorrect 0 ms 212 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Correct 1 ms 212 KB Output is correct
2 Correct 12 ms 528 KB Output is correct
3 Correct 36 ms 1344 KB Output is correct
4 Correct 22 ms 1488 KB Output is correct
5 Correct 58 ms 1464 KB Output is correct
6 Correct 22 ms 1484 KB Output is correct
7 Correct 26 ms 1464 KB Output is correct
8 Correct 56 ms 1364 KB Output is correct
# 결과 실행 시간 메모리 Grader output
1 Incorrect 0 ms 212 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 3 ms 360 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 0 ms 212 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 0 ms 212 KB Output isn't correct
2 Halted 0 ms 0 KB -